The Benefits and Drawbacks of Consuming Bananas for Breakfast Bananas are undoubtedly a nutritious fruit, providing a significant amount of vitamin B6 and 10% of the recommended daily intake of vitamin C. However, relying solely on bananas as a breakfast option is not recommended by health experts. Bananas are composed of approximately 25% sugar, which can provide a rapid surge of energy in the morning. Unfortunately, this quick sugar boost may not sustain you throughout the entire morning, potentially leading to a mid-morning "crash" and feelings of fatigue and increased hunger. This scenario suggests that consuming a banana alone for breakfast may do more harm than good. To address this concern, experts advise pairing your morning banana with additional food items, such as a boiled egg or pancakes.
